By now you know BCHS advanced to the elite eight of the GHSA football playoffs for the first time since 2006 with a 41-7 win at Early County Friday night. Jahvon Butler had 74 yards on 17 carries and two touchdowns.

Chuckie Stephens had 50 yards on 15 carries and two scores. The Royals travel to Rabun County for their next game.
